Role: Vehicle Progressor – Junior Sales Executive Location: Hinckley, Leicestershire Hours: Full Time: 42.5 hours per week. 5 days out of 7 Pay: £30,000 We’re seeking an organised and proactive Vehicle Progressor at a large independent Used Car Supermarket. With an average of 550–600 fully prepped vehicles on-site. The Benefits * A competitive salary * 28 days holiday * Ongoing training and opportunities for career development – an ideal opportunity for someone with an interest in beginning a career in Car Sales to gain industry & showroom experience * Being part of a supportive, fast-growing, high-energy team environment The Role: * Managing daily appointments and coordinating the sales team to ensure all vehicles are cleaned, prepped, and ready to be viewed * Liaising with Sales, Valeting, and the Prep Centre to make sure sold vehicles are ready for customer handover * Overseeing the smooth running of the showroom and supporting the sales process, working closely with sales controllers to maximise every opportunity * Handling any aftersales issues professionally and efficiently * Checking in all new stock arriving from the Prep Centre, ensuring vehicles meet our high preparation standards before going on sale The Requirements: * A highly organised, detail-driven individual who thrives in a busy, fast-paced environment * Strong communication skills and the ability to work closely with multiple departments * A hands-on, proactive approach with a commitment to delivering excellent customer service * A confident team player who can take responsibility and drive results * Full UK driving licence required If you’re ready to step into a role where organisation meets opportunity, and you want to grow your career as a Vehicle Progressor in Hinkley, while keeping the showroom in top gear – we want to hear from you. This could be a great first step into Car Sales for someone keen to gain industry experience, or with experience in another sector of the Motor Trade
